Following hard on the launch of its 1000W bass amp, Peavey’s new MiniMega and MiniMax bass amp heads have now arrived in the UK.
The MiniMega has 1000-watts of Peavey tone in a compact, highly portable package with its smaller brother, the MiniMAX offering 500-watts in a compact unit weighing only 5.6lbs.
The MiniMega features an effects loop, gain control, crunch button, tuner output and a 4-band EQ with Punch and Bright switches and semi-parametric mids. Peavey’s exclusive Kosmos bass enhancement function provides increased bass impact for extra punch, while the psychoacoustic low-end controls add more bass without overloading speakers. It also boasts customisable control surface lighting to the MiniMega to allow players to choose how they want the amp to appear on stage.
The 500-watt MiniMax features a 3-band with Punch, Mid-shift and Bright controls to provide an array of tone shaping options. A pre-gain control with TransTube gain boost allows a tube-like crunch sound to be added. It also benefits from the psychoacoustic low-end bass enhancement found in the MiniMega.
Both models feature Peavey’s DDT speaker protection technology and come with carry bags. All of the connectivity necessary to join to sound reinforcement systems and patch in effects is built into both amps, making them suitable for use in live and studio environments.
